The Juvenile Driver Improvement Program or Juvenile Remedial is a six-hour course required by courts and Ohio BMV for teens who have received a second or third traffic conviction. In Ohio, a young driver must: Complete a driver education class at a licensed driver training school, which includes 24 hours of classroom or online instruction and 8 hours of behind-the-wheel training.Thus making the student exempt from taking the final road test at a DMV center. Choosing the driver education program that’s right for your teen Take the time to find a quality driving schoolone that focuses on your teen’s safety instead of a driving school that is the least expensive, most convenient or focused solely on teens passing the driving test.
